3.06.1 - Deutlich sichtbarer Tastaturfokus

Aus BIT inklusiv Wiki und Test-Case-Datenbank
Wechseln zu: Navigation, Suche

Beschreibung

[Technikneutrale Beschreibung des Erfolgskriteriums]

Der Tastaturfokus ist deutlich sichtbar, so dass er von Menschen mit leicht eingeschränkter Sehfähigkeit ohne Anstrengung gefunden werden kann.

 

Beispiele

[Typische Anwendungsbeispiele aus verschiedenen Plattformen]

Im Hauptmenü einer Anwendung wird der Tastaturfokus durch invertierte Farben angezeigt.

In einem E-Mail-Client wird der Tastaturfokus in der Liste der eingegangenen Mails durch einen andersfarbigen Hintergrund und eine Rahmenlinie am linken Rand angezeigt.

Um das Kontrollkästchen, das fokussiert wird, wenn der Benutzer eine Pfeiltaste anschlägt, erscheint ein Rahmen oder ein markierter Bereich.

Um die Schaltfläche, die fokussiert wird, erscheint ein gepunkteter Rahmen.

Ein Text-Indikator (ein blinkender senkrechter Strich) erscheint im Dateneingabefeld an der Stelle, an der die eingegebenen Zeichen eingefügt werden.

 

Anwendbarkeit

[manche Erfolgskriterien sind nur in speziellen Kontexten anwendbar]

Der Prüfschritt ist immer anwendbar.

 

Begründung

[Warum wird das geprüft? Bedeutung des Prüfpunktes für Menschen mit Behinderungen]

Für den Tastaturbenutzer ist es wichtig, zu sehen, wo sich der Tastaturfokus gerade befindet, welche Aktion also ausgelöst wird, wenn er die Enter-Taste drückt, bzw. an welcher Stelle eingegebene Zeichen erscheinen werden. Ohne sichtbaren Tastaturfokus ist eine Anwendung für optisch orientierte Menschen praktisch nicht tastaturbedienbar.

Deutlich sichtbar ist der Tastaturfokus, wenn er von Normalsichtigen ebenso wie von Menschen mit leichter Einschränkung des Sehens, die aus Farbfehlsichtigkeit oder aus normaler Alterung resultiert, bei der durch Tastenanschläge hervorgerufenen Bewegung ohne Anstrengung gefunden werden kann. Die Bedingungen für gute Sichtbarkeit sind definiert in den Prüfschritten 1.01.0 „Ausreichender Kontrast“ und 1.07.1 „Informationen nicht allein durch Farbe übermitteln“.

 

Prüfanleitung

[Technikspezifische Prüfanleitung (oder Prüfvorschlag) mit Tools zur Unterstützung des praktischen Tests]

Sichtprüfung im Anschluss an Prüfschritt 3.01.0 „Tastaturbedienung für Bedienelemente“: ist der Fokus sichtbar?

Weitere Prüfung der deutlichen Sichtbarkeit wie in den Prüfschritten 1.01.0 „Ausreichender Kontrast“ und 1.07.1 „Informationen nicht allein durch Farbe übermitteln“.

 

Bewertungsalternativen

[Abgrenzung von „erfüllt“ und „nicht erfüllt“, sowie von „Blockade/Barriere“ und „Einschränkung“]

Wenn der Tastaturfokus in ganzen Bereichen der Anwendung nicht sichtbar ist, so ist dies eine Blockade.

Wenn der Tastaturfokus für mehr als 3 Tastenanschläge nicht sichtbar ist, so ist dies eine Barriere.

Wenn der Tastaturfokus schwach sichtbar ist, so ist dies eine Einschränkung.

 

Einordnung

[Abgrenzung zu anderen Prüfschritten]

In diesem Prüfschritt geht es um die Normalansicht des Tastaturfokus. Die Konfiguration einer stärkeren optischen Hervorhebung für Menschen mit Sehbehinderungen ist Gegenstand des Prüfschritts 6.02.2 „Hilfsmittel zum Auffinden des Zeigers zur Verfügung stellen“.

 

Offene Fragen

[Fragen sammeln, die während der Entwicklung des Prüfschritts auftauchen]

Eine strengere Definition von „deutlich sichtbar“ wird in ISO 9241-171 Nr. 9.2.2 „Für deutliche Sichtbarkeit des Tastaturfokus- und Text-Indikators sorgen“ gegeben, die diskussionswürdig erscheint. Denn ein grell gestalteter Tastaturfokus kann auch ablenken, wenn die Arbeitsaufgabe die Konzentration auf Informationen abseits der Tastatureingabe verlangt. Daher sollte der Fokus für Menschen mit Sehbehinderungen konfigurierbar sein.

 

Referenzen

EN301549

11.2.4.7 Focus visible

WCAG

2.4.7 Fokus sichtbar: Jede durch Tastatur bedienbare Benutzerschnittstelle hat einen Bedienmodus, bei dem der Tastaturfokus sichtbar ist.

WCAG-Techniques

ISO9241-171

9.2.1 Tastaturfokus- und Text-Indikator zur Verfügung stellen

9.2.2 Für deutliche Sichtbarkeit des Tastaturfokus- und Text-Indikators sorgen